‘Legends of Tomorrow’ spoilers: Patrick J. Adams will not play Booster Gold

LegendsGiven the amount of buzz regarding one casting possibility for Patrick J. Adams on “DC’s Legends of Tomorrow,” we figured that there was a certain degree of value in clarifying things at the moment.

As first reported by TVLine, the “Suits” star is not going to be playing the part of time-traveling hero Booster Gold, someone who has been the subject of many rumors over the years with one show or another. From our vantage point, it’s clear that there are plans for this character somewhere in between the movies and the television universe, since he is well-known enough that we believe that he would have probably turned up otherwise.

Adams’ appearance will come at the end of the season, and for the time being all that we can say for certain is that he will be playing a particularly popular person within the universe. There are a lot of different possibilities that inherently come with that, but we don’t expect him to be a permanent member of the team or anything of the sort. Adams is a regular on “Suits”; as a matter of fact, we do not think the show would go on without him. Given that it has another season to film premiering over the summer, he is going to be rather busy.

Meanwhile, the “Legends of Tomorrow” finale will air on May 19. There is going to be more or less a new episode airing every week between now and then, which is hopefully going to stabilize the show somehow and help it overcome some of the problems that it has been labeled with so far.
